Real Madrid suffered a shocking defeat against Sheriff Tiraspol in the Champions League fixture, and Carlo Ancelotti had nothing but luck to blame. Los Blancos facing the first time qualifying Sheriff in the Champions League looked an easy win for Madrid on paper. But what we saw on the pitch was totally different from it, as Sheriff won the match by 2-1.

Seeing the stats nobody can believe how Real Madrid lost against the newcomers. Los Blancos had the most possession in the game with 75% of the ball with them. While Madrid had a total of 31 shots towards the Sheriff goal, but they only scored one goal that to from the penalty shot.

From the starting of the game, Real Madrid looked dangerous with the ball while defending on the high line to get an early lead. But it was Sheriff Tiraspol who opened the scoring in the 25th minute from Jasurbek Yakhshiboev. Madrid equalized the score in the 65th minute as Karim Benzema scored from a penalty kick. After that Real Madrid had several chances to go on a lead but their poor finishing came in the way.

Taking advantage of Madrid’s poor finishing Sheriff scored the second goal in the 89th minute. Sebastien Thill scored a beautiful goal as he shot a half-volley into the goal from outside the box. Following which Sheriff had a historic win against the Spanish giants Real Madrid by a 2-1 scoreline.

Talking about the shocking defeat in the post-match conference, Carlo Ancelotti didn’t have any explanation about it. As per Carlo Ancelotti, Real Madrid did everything they could, but it was a hard-luck that they couldn’t win. While from the stats after the game it really looked like it was bad luck for Real Madrid. However, Ancelotti said his team will come back stronger after the Sheriff defeat.
